  7. Hi lads Went to see my local electronic chap today. He also suggested the same thing as Kingy, to put a resistor in the mic. So he did, although Kingy suggested putting a 47k in, the electronic chap advised putting a 100k in as my mic gain on my vmx1000 is on 0.
